Vegas Post 20 365 Crashes Searching For VST Plugins

Sassylola wrote on 9/9/2022, 4:09 PM

I have been in contact with Magix support now for a few weeks and all of the solutions offered have not worked.

When I open Vegas it will search for VST Plugins and at 50 to 75% it will crash offering me a error report to send. If I hold Shift/Ctrl Vegas will start normal, or restart my PC. When I uninstalled Vegas 19 thinking there was a conflict, 20 would get to the VST plugin and the splash screen would just disappear without a error report to send.. I reinstalled 19 and now a error report comes up to send with 20 when it crashes.

I do not have third party VST plugins installed.

This does not happen all of the time, but it happens more than it does not happen. Vegas will start normal then if i shut the program down and I go to restart it it will crash as in the video.

I have a AMD Radeon VII running AMD driver version 22.5.1. I was running the currant Pro driver and Vegas still would not start up most of the time. I have used KillAllVegas script and that does not help. I have Vegas Post 19 installed and that starts up with no crashes. I have used Revo Uninstaller to uninstall Vegas and reinstall, but that has not helped.

Windows 11 Pro, Ryzen 3900X, 64 GB DDR 4 3600mhz memory, Latest Asus X570 Pro BIOS.

PC is stable never crashes.

Any suggestions? Thanks

After uninstalling Vegas Post 20 365 with Revo Uninstaller, I reinstalled Post 20 and when it got to the searching for VST plugins it would crash again with a error report. I sent the error report to Magix. After the report was sent the Vegas splash screen would not close and freeze, I had to use KILLALLVEGAS to close the splash screen

After looking at the error report and seeing that the sfvstwrap.dll was causing these issues, I deleted it and now Vegas opens with no crashes. BUT I have no VST plugins installed within Vegas now. I do not know if this will affect the stability of Vegas with this file deleted? but so far I am having no problems. I sent this to Magix support. Thanks for all of the help and suggestions. I may be running a crippled Vegas, but I never used the VST plugins anyway.

Howard-Vigorita wrote on 9/13/2022, 1:09 PM

Found another way to make it stop. Check the box for "Generic VST Editor", apply, and restart. The checkmark is still there after restart, it's just invisible. If you want the crashes back, just clear the invisible checkmark and apply again. This is probably a better workaround than deleting or renaming the dll... because it'll likely come back with every Vegas update.

Sassylola wrote on 9/13/2022, 3:58 PM

I received a response today from Magix Support.


This appears to be a known issue specifically with VST Wrapper and VP20. We are currently developing a fix for it but it will likely not be released until the next update.
